Apples are a staple in many healthy diets, celebrated for their fiber, vitamins, and antioxidants. But for anyone who loves baked apples, applesauce, or apple pie, a common question arises: does cooking apples remove nutrients? The answer is more complex than a simple yes or no, as heat affects different nutrients in different ways. While some heat-sensitive vitamins are diminished, other beneficial compounds can become more bioavailable.
The Effect of Heat on Apple Nutrients
When you apply heat to an apple, several key nutritional changes occur. These changes are primarily dependent on the type of nutrient. Water-soluble vitamins are most susceptible to degradation, while other components like fiber and specific antioxidants can become more accessible to the body.
Vitamin C Loss
Vitamin C is sensitive to heat, and cooking apples will likely reduce their vitamin C content. As a water-soluble vitamin, it can also leach into cooking water. However, apples are not a primary source of vitamin C for most people.
Polyphenol Potency
Antioxidants like polyphenols in apple skin and flesh offer health benefits. Cooking can break down cell walls, making these antioxidants more readily absorbed. Studies indicate some cooking methods, such as microwaving and boiling, can preserve or even increase the total phenolic content and antioxidant capacity.
Enhanced Fiber and Pectin
Apples are rich in fiber. Cooking softens the fruit and makes the fiber easier to digest. It can also increase the bioavailability of pectin. Pectin supports beneficial gut bacteria. Peeling the apple before cooking removes much of the fiber in the skin.
Comparison: Raw vs. Cooked Apples
| Feature | Raw Apples | Cooked Apples | 
|---|---|---|
| Vitamin C | Higher content | Reduced content due to heat and leaching | 
| Polyphenols | High content, but less bioavailable | Can have similar or higher bioavailability, especially when skin is kept on | 
| Fiber | High content, especially in the skin | Softens, making it easier to digest. Pectin becomes more bioavailable | 
| Pectin | Present, but less bioavailable | More bioavailable and effective for gut health | 
| Digestion | Can be more challenging for sensitive guts | Easier to digest due to softened fiber | 
| Texture | Crisp and firm | Soft and tender | 
| Sugar | Natural fruit sugar | Concentrated natural sugar | 
Cooking Tips to Maximize Apple Nutrients
To preserve nutritional value when cooking apples:
- Keep the skin on: The skin contains much of the fiber and polyphenols.
- Minimize water: Use minimal water as water-soluble nutrients can leach out.
- Opt for quicker cooking methods: Microwaving and steaming can reduce nutrient loss compared to long boiling times.
- Avoid excessive sugar: Cooking concentrates sweetness. Use spices like cinnamon instead.
- Combine with healthy fats: This can aid in the absorption of fat-soluble vitamins and improve overall nutrient uptake.

Conclusion: A Balanced Perspective
While cooking reduces some nutrients like vitamin C, it enhances the bioavailability of others, such as polyphenols and pectin. The healthiest approach is to enjoy both raw and cooked apples to benefit from their distinct nutritional profiles. By keeping the skin on and choosing appropriate cooking methods, you can maximize the nutritional advantages of this versatile fruit.
